Mayor Minnie Blackwell recently visited the all new Coastal Kids Dental for a guided tour to see what all the talk has been about
since they opened last August in Tanner Ford Plantation, Hanahan.

"We enjoy seeing children in the surrounding areas and have also started to see patients at a dental office in Moncks Corner, since October, and will start seeing patients on Daniel Island in February." Said Dr. Isabel Driggers.
Coastal Kids Dentalputs the emphasis on making a dental experience an enjoyable one.

Each room is designed for children to recognize the area and experience the happiness of the outdoors. The goal at Coastal Kids Dental is to provide each of their patients with a healthy adult smile, Dr. Isabel said, " we advocate and practice early ntervention
and consistent monitoring of growth and development," she said.

February is Dental Health month and Dr. Isabel would be thrilled to take you on a tour. They are planning and scheduling visits to area schools and daycares to discuss children's dental health and the importance of brushing and flossing. Dr. Isabel welcomes
all patients 1 to 18 and special needs individuals of all ages.
